DECOR ON A DIME 
1205 Rymal Rd. E. decoronadime.ca

With so many pieces of furniture being unnecessarily sent to the landfill, it only made sense for there to be a place you would go to buy well-loved furniture and home decor in one place. As a consignment store, Decor on a Dime prices pieces with the customer in mind and as a result of that they continue to buy, sell and consign furniture and thousands of home accent pieces a week since 2007. In addition to being a must-visit in home decor shopping, they also offer workshops suitable for any member of the family. 

STYLE ENCORE
989 Fennel Ave. E. Unit #7  style-encorehamilton.com

Why buy brand new when you can look great at a fraction of the price and save the planet? At Style Encore, customers are encouraged to "consume less, and express more." Just by buying and selling items, you are a part of a very sustainable, eco-conscious lifestyle that's equally stylish and sophisticated. Recycled clothing saves hundreds to thousands of gallons of water and millions of barrels of oil, elements used to make just a single new garment. By bringing in and selling your gently-used items, you are saving nearly 81 pounds of textiles waste a year; items that would otherwise be placed in landfills. It truly pays to be eco-friendly! 

GREEN VENTURE
22 Veevers Dr.  greenventure.ca

Green Venture is dedicated to finding the most positive, practical and long-lasting ways to make Hamilton and area the most environmentally friendly place to be. The EcoHouse has a rich variety of demonstrations best seen through an education program, as part of workshops, or during an open-house special event. But Green Venture also offers self-guided tours of the EcoHouse and grounds. A series of strategically placed posters and displays can provide an illuminating look at topics of environment interest, or alternatively those of heritage interest for the Glen Manor property. Green Venture is open to public Monday to Friday 9am to 4pm.
